Religious charities are organizations that operate based on religious principles and aims to provide support, aid, and assistance to those in need, regardless of their beliefs.
Key Features
- Provide aid and support to those in need
- Operate based on religious principles
- Focus on giving back to the community
- Promote spiritual well-being
Pros
- Often have strong values and principles guiding their work
- Can reach out to specific religious communities in need
- Provide a sense of belonging and community for both volunteers and recipients
Cons
- May come with strings attached or require recipients to adhere to specific religious beliefs
- Potential for discrimination or exclusion based on religious beliefs
- Can sometimes use aid as a tool for proselytization
